Car keys and FOBs have circuitry, and a special transponder chip that must be programmed to start the car. In the past, these chips were installed inside the cylinder of ignition however, as technology improved, these chips moved to the key fobs. This made the key fobs more secure and harder to duplicate, but it also increased the cost of repairs and replacements due to the fact that the new key fobs had to be programmed by an automotive locksmith or dealer in order to work.

Many locksmiths for automotive are now capable of working with the newer systems. They can program the new FOBs to work with your car, and even remove older ones that don't work. The cost will vary depending on your vehicle's year, make and model.

The type of key that you require will also impact the cost. There are two types of keys for cars that the majority of automobiles have: a conventional metal key that's not connected to a fob or any other electronic component and a remote FOB that controls the ignition and unlocks or unlocks the doors. The former type is usually the least expensive to replace since it does not require programming and is able to be cut by an automotive locksmith using a specific blank.

Car keys are electronic devices with batteries and circuitry. They also have a transmitter that transmits a number to the car to open its doors and begin the engine. They are expensive to replace in the event that you have them stolen or damaged. The cost of a key is typically not that expensive but the effort to cut and program the new key for your specific car is what really adds up. The cost of a new key can differ greatly based on the complexity, type, and dealer.

The location of your home can affect the cost of the purchase of a new car key. If you reside in rural areas, there could be less automotive locksmiths to help you. You may have to pay more if you live in a rural area because they will need to travel further to reach you. If you are in Chicago there are many options for automotive locksmiths.
